The Rise of a Titan: How Uttar Pradesh is Rewriting India’s Manufacturing Narrative

For decades, coastal powerhouses like Maharashtra, Gujarat, Tamil Nadu, and Karnataka held an absolute monopoly over India’s industrial landscape. However, a monumental shift is reshaping the nation’s economic geography. Uttar Pradesh (UP)—traditionally viewed through an agricultural or political lens—is rapidly positioning itself as one of the country’s fastest-growing and most diversified manufacturing destinations.

Driven by massive infrastructure pipelines, robust investor-friendly policies, and a strategic pivot into next-generation deep technology, India’s most populous state is turning its landlocked geography into its greatest competitive asset.

1. Turning Geography into a Competitive Edge

Situated in the heart of Northern India, Uttar Pradesh acts as a critical bridge connecting major domestic consumption markets, including Delhi-NCR, Rajasthan, Madhya Pradesh, Bihar, Uttarakhand, and eastern India. From a single production base in UP, a manufacturer can efficiently distribute products to a consumer base of over half a billion people. This geographic positioning dramatically reduces domestic transportation costs and shortens supply chain turnaround times.

2. The Expressway and Logistics Revolution

The backbone of the Uttar Pradesh manufacturing industry growth is its unprecedented infrastructure expansion. The state has built a world-class network of expressways that seamlessly link regional production centers:

  • The Network: Key operational arteries like the Purvanchal Expressway, Bundelkhand Expressway, and Agra-Lucknow Expressway are being joined by mega-projects like the upcoming Ganga Expressway.

  • Freight and Multimodal Transit: Beyond roads, UP is leveraging the Eastern Dedicated Freight Corridor (EDFC), enabling high-speed cargo movement to maritime ports. Simultaneously, Integrated Manufacturing Clusters (IMCs) adhering to Industry 4.0 standards—such as those evaluated under the PM GatiShakti principles in Agra and Prayagraj—are creating plug-and-play environments for swift setup.

3. Industrial Corridors & The High-Tech Pivot

Rather than scattered growth, UP’s expansion is structured across highly specialized industrial corridors.

The Electronics and Semiconductor Surge

Noida and Greater Noida have evolved from regional satellite towns into global manufacturing capitals for smartphones, wearable devices, and LED televisions. Major investment booms, like the HCL-Foxconn project near the upcoming Jewar International Airport, are anchoring specialized semiconductor ecosystems in the state.

The Defence Industrial Corridor

The UP Defence Industrial Corridor links six core nodes: Lucknow, Kanpur, Jhansi, Agra, Aligarh, and Chitrakoot. Backed by reforms like the national Defence Acquisition Procedure (DAP) prioritizing indigenously designed items, this corridor is producing everything from precision aerospace components to advanced military hardware.

The Deep-Tech Leap (2026 Shift)

Uttar Pradesh is no longer focused solely on heavy physical manufacturing. The state has aggressively expanded into deep tech, launching the UP AI Mission backed by a targeted multi-crore roadmap to establish India’s first dedicated AI City in Lucknow. Noida has simultaneously become the primary hub for hyper-scale data centers in Northern India, providing the necessary processing backbone for advanced robotics, cybersecurity, and hardware manufacturing.

4. Empowering the Grassroots: MSMEs and Local Labor

UP boasts one of India’s largest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ises (MSME) networks. Traditional artisan clusters—ranging from leather goods in Kanpur to brassware in Moradabad and carpets in Bhadohi—are receiving tech upgrades, simplified credit lines, and direct export assistance.

Supporting this massive industrial engine is a population exceeding 240 million. To convert this demographic asset into skilled capital, the state is heavily funding industry-oriented vocational training, technical universities, and polytechnic institutes to ensure precision engineering and electronics assembly lines remain continuously supplied with local talent.

5. Policy Boosters: Improving Ease of Doing Business

The sudden rush of domestic and foreign direct investment is a direct result of comprehensive regulatory easing. The state offers:

  • Substantial capital and interest subsidies.

  • Stamp duty and electricity duty exemptions.

  • A robust single-window clearance system that cuts through bureaucratic red tape for faster project approvals.

6. Key Challenges Ahead

To maintain long-term competitiveness, state planners are actively focusing on remaining bottlenecks:

  • Accelerating industrial land acquisition processes.

  • Ensuring an uninterrupted, high-quality power supply to remote industrial zones.

  • Upgrading urban amenities and housing infrastructure directly around rapidly expanding manufacturing clusters.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What major sectors are driving the manufacturing boom in Uttar Pradesh?

A: Growth is highly diversified, led primarily by smartphones and consumer electronics, defense equipment, automotive components, pharmaceuticals, food processing, and textiles.

Q2: Which cities form the core nodes of the UP Defence Industrial Corridor?

A: The corridor interconnects six strategic nodes across the state: Lucknow, Kanpur, Jhansi, Agra, Aligarh, and Chitrakoot.

Q3: How is Uttar Pradesh supporting high-tech industries like AI and semiconductors?

A: UP has established dedicated semiconductor hubs near Jewar and launched the UP AI Mission, which includes a blueprint for an AI City in Lucknow alongside hyper-scale data centers in Noida.
